Output af84163076fa622dfeed19683048e21cbecef92272445b0d61302f89a6c1856d:0

value
1980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2738b82244e0e3fcc98f8ca53de2a8db2c20490b OP_EQUAL
address
35GQDx1jYnu1eB9HLpVKJobmDHNRwgFGs9
transaction
af84163076fa622dfeed19683048e21cbecef92272445b0d61302f89a6c1856d
spent
true